浏览代码

rules: fix HTTPS variable not set for some servers

Signed-off-by: Beta Soft <betaxab@gmail.com>
Beta Soft 5 年之前
父节点
当前提交
55118d7706
共有 1 个文件被更改,包括 1 次插入1 次删除
  1. 1 1
      app/Http/Controllers/Client/ClientController.php

+ 1 - 1
app/Http/Controllers/Client/ClientController.php

@@ -124,7 +124,7 @@ class ClientController extends Controller
 
         // Subscription link
         $subsURL = 'http';
-        if ($_SERVER['HTTPS'] == 'on') {
+        if (isset( $_SERVER['HTTPS'] ) && strtolower( $_SERVER['HTTPS'] ) == 'on') {
             $subsURL .= 's';
         }
         $subsURL .= '://';